摘要
Asymmetric induction in the allylic alkylation of cycloalkenediol diacetates was performed using a chiral alkylphosphine ligand bearing a carboxyl group, 3-(diphenylphosphino)butanoic acid. An increase in enantiomeric excess of the monoalkylated products of cis-cycloalkenediol diacetates was observed through a sequential asymmetric allylic alkylation-kinetic resolution process.
